Normal range for walking is 9-18 months. Nick is just now starting to pull up on things, but he just started crawling at 12 months. EI probably wouldn't take her unless there was a huge motor delay unless there was other areas of concern. If you really wanted to have her evaluated I'm sure they would do it.
We have Nick in EI because he still wasn't crawling or pulling up etc at 10 months.
Timmy started scooting around 9-10 months and didn't walk until 16 months.
Encourage her to pull up on toys, side sit, and high kneel. Try to get her to stand with the least amount of support.
